Jaat Day 5: Sunny Deol’s Film Holds Strong on First Monday!

'Jaat' is produced by Mythri Movie Makers and People Media Factory. The film was released on April 10, starring Sunny Deol as the protagonist.

Sunny Deol’s latest films,’Jaat’, passed the Monday test at the box office with strong business. The Gopichand Malineni directional registered a good first Monday with Rs. 7.50 crore nett (approx.), taking the total of five days to Rs 47.75 crore nett, reported the trade website Sacnilk.

Interestingly, the film’s Monday business was more than what it collected on its first Friday. ‘Jaat’, which also stars Randeep Hooda and Viineet Kumar Siingh in important roles, impressed the audience with a fantastic collection on its first Sunday, and Monday didn’t disappoint either.

Check the day-wise box office breakup of ‘Jaat’ after five days – nett collection (source: Sacnilk)

Thursday: Rs 9.5 crore
Friday: Rs 7 crore
Saturday: Rs 9.75 crore
Sunday: Rs 14 crore
Monday: Rs 7.50 crore
Total: Rs 47.75 crore 

With no competition from any new Hindi release, ‘Jaat’ has got a clear window until Friday, April 18, when Akshay Kumar’s ‘Kesari Chapter 2’ hits the screens. The film is expected to cross the benchmark of Rs 50 crore by the end of Tuesday, and it will be interesting to see if it manages to cross the benchmark of Rs 100 crore by the end of its second weekend or not.
